Month Long Investor Roadshow Concludes with Highlight at BYU

By Emily Ziethen | Tue Jan 12 2016
Matt and Laura Davis, partners of RENEW and founding angel investors of the Impact Angel Network, recently completed a month-long investor roadshow that spanned coast to coast, from Boston and New York to San Francisco and Portland.
One of the highlights of the trip was RENEW’s time with the students and faculty members of Brigham Young University (BYU) in Provo, Utah. Laura and Matt met with many bright and driven individuals from the Physics and Astronomy Department and the Ballard Center for Economic Self Reliance - it was truly an impressive group! The partners especially enjoyed having lunch with the students, hosted by the Physics and Astronomy Department, hearing about their current degrees and their plans for pursuing careers. Matt and Laura had many memorable conversations and one-on-ones with the faculty members, as well.
Part of Matt’s day at BYU included a colloquium on the rise of and need for impact investing in emerging economies. Matt’s presentation started out with some personal stories on how he, as a physics student himself, became involved in the world of international development and investment. Matt then went on to further explain how small to med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in many African countries are experiencing a deep financing constraint, which in turn creates a “missing middle” in the economy. This is a pressing issue, as SMEs tend to be the engines of growth, create jobs, provide local goods and services, and generate tax revenue. Luckily, a solution exists in the form of impact investing.
Matt wrapped up the presentation by explaining how there is a world of opportunities for physics students, especially in finance-based positions, and that by leveraging their scientific backgrounds, they can in turn tackle global problems in completely new ways.
Renew Capital is an Africa-focused impact investment firm that backs innovative companies with high-growth potential. Renew Capital manages investments made on behalf of the Renew Capital Angels, a global network of angel investors, foundations and family offices who seek financial returns and sustainable social impact.
